Product AB passes through two processes A and B before it is transferred to finished stock. The following information is obtained for the month of January:

Process A (Rs.)  Process B (Rs.)  Finished Stock (Rs) 
Opening Stock  12,000 15,000 20,000
Direct Material  30,000 40,00 -
Direct Wages  25,00 30,000 -
Factory Overhead  20,000 30,000 -
Closing Stock  7,000 15,000 20,000
Inter -process profit included in Opening Stock   - 3,125 9,750

   The output of process A is transferred to process B at 25% profit on the cost price.

    The output of process B is transferred to finished stock at 25% profit on cost price.

    The stocks in process are valued at prime cost. The finished stock is valued at the price at which it is received from process B. Sales during the period are Rs. 300,000.

Required:

 a. Process Account

 b. Finished Stock Account

c. Actual realized profit

d. Stock valuation for Balance Sheet purpose (5+5+3+1+1)
